Flashing repair services involve fixing or replacing the metal or plastic strips, known as flashings, that are installed around roof features, chimneys, vents, skylights, and other areas where the roof intersects with walls or other structures. These components serve as a barrier to direct water away from vulnerable spots, preventing leaks and water intrusion. When flashings become damaged, corroded, or improperly installed, they can fail to perform their protective function, leading to potential water damage inside the property. Professional repair or replacement ensures that the flashing system maintains its integrity and continues to shield the roof and interior from moisture-related issues.
This service is essential for addressing a variety of problems that can compromise a property's roof and exterior. Common issues include rusted or cracked flashings, missing or loose sections, and improper sealing around roof penetrations. These problems often result in water seeping into the attic or interior walls, causing stains, mold growth, or structural deterioration over time. Repairing or replacing faulty flashings helps prevent these issues and extends the lifespan of the roof. Property owners may notice signs such as water stains on ceilings, peeling paint, or increased moisture levels, indicating that flashing work might be needed.

The overview below groups typical Flashing Repair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Green Bay,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or flashing repairs in Green Bay range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and materials needed.
Moderate Replacements - replacing sections of flashing or upgrading existing systems usually costs between $600 and $1,200. Larger, more involved projects tend to push costs toward the higher end of this range.
Full Roof Flashing Replacement - complete replacement of roof flashing can range from $1,200 to $3,500, with most projects falling in the middle. Complex or larger roofs may reach higher costs, especially if additional repairs are required.
Complex or Custom Projects - extensive or custom flashing work, such as for new construction or specialized designs, can exceed $5,000. These projects are less common and typically involve detailed planning and materials.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
